What Comes in a Star Wars: Unlimited Booster Box?
A typical booster box contains:
- 24 booster packs
- Each pack includes:
- 9 Commons
- 3 Uncommons
- 1 Rare or Legendary
- 1 Foil card (any rarity)
Booster Boxes are the most efficient way to gather playsets, build multiple decks, and chase premium foils.
